Output 21e6ded6bd45424863f9a17b3fed9f0e71f4dc705406a8f48d5ba433a9bd658e:0

value
2043134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e615372c9a8ff56bae538613229434ce33a9a8b9 OP_EQUAL
address
3NfakkBBtzxW4RTZs2k9UeXGAUz854S2Ez
transaction
21e6ded6bd45424863f9a17b3fed9f0e71f4dc705406a8f48d5ba433a9bd658e
spent
true